Adani Airport Holdings Limited (AAHL), in partnership with Bastian Hospitality, has launched Maison Twenty-Seven, an integrated lifestyle, hospitality and wellness destination at Sardar Vallabhbhai Patel International Airport (SVPIA), Ahmedabad. The new development is located adjacent to Terminal 2 (T2), near the arrivals area, marking a significant expansion of AAHL’s vision to transform airports into dynamic lifestyle ecosystems beyond traditional transit hubs.
Spread across 52,000 square feet, Maison Twenty-Seven has been designed as a first-of-its-kind airport-linked experience centre that blends luxury dining, wellness, fitness, recovery, entertainment, and curated social spaces under one roof. The destination caters not only to travellers but also to business professionals, families, and urban consumers in Ahmedabad and the surrounding GIFT City corridor.
The project reflects AAHL’s broader strategy of developing airport-centric urban ecosystems, further strengthened by its collaborations aimed at building hospitality-linked infrastructure across key Indian cities. For Bastian Hospitality, the launch represents its most ambitious expansion as it completes a decade of operations in India’s premium dining and lifestyle segment.
Maison Twenty-Seven features layered architectural design with open, light-filled spaces, greenery, and immersive social zones. Its culinary offerings are rooted in Bastian’s signature hospitality philosophy, adapted for modern travel, wellness, and lifestyle-driven consumption patterns, covering everything from transit dining to business meetings and casual experiences.
Wellness is a central focus of the destination, offering advanced facilities including cryotherapy, HBOT (hyperbaric oxygen therapy), steam and sauna rooms, plunge pools, flotation therapy, yoga, sound healing, salon services, and fitness zones. The space is designed as an urban retreat promoting recovery, relaxation, and mindful living.
The destination operates on a reservation-based model along with curated day-pass access, encouraging flexible engagement and repeat visits.
